![]() Synopsis True Blood is an American television drama series created and produced by Alan Ball. It is based on The Southern Vampire Mysteries series of novels by Charlaine Harris, detailing the co-existence of vampires and humans in Bon Temps, a fictional, small town in northwestern Louisiana. The series centers on the adventures of Sookie Stackhouse (Anna Paquin), a telepathic waitress with an otherworldly quality. Joe Manganiello isn't Happy with How "True Blood" Ended
by Jessica Wang March 13, 2024 Joe Manganiello's time in Bon Temps left something to be desired. In a new interview, the "True Blood" actor admitted that he wasn't happy with how the supernatural drama concluded back in 2014. In fact, the abrupt and ignoble death of his fan-favorite character, the hunky werewolf Alcide Herveaux, early in the final season of the HBO show left him eager to make up for it. "I thought there was so much left on the table for me," Manganiello, 47, said on Andy Cohen's SiriusXM show. "The thing about it was they never planned for me to be on the show past one season. I was signed up as a guest star my first season, and when my character really broke and people really loved the character, they were kind of unprepared for that to happen." He continued: "I wound up on the show for five years in total, but my character had to get out of the way so that Sookie [Anna Paquin] could wind up settling the A and B plots with Bill [Stephen Moyer] and Eric [Alexander Skarsgård], and the only way to get me out of the way was — spoiler alert — you know, to shoot me in the face. I really felt like there was a lot that was left unexplored." As a result, Manganiello said, "I'm always on the lookout for like a good werewolf script for me because… I feel like there's a lot in me that was unfinished.
